网络流量监测技术探究:如何快速识别网络攻击并采取措施 随着网络的普及和应用,网络安全问题的重要性越来越突出。其中网络攻击是网络安全中比较常见的问题,给网络带来了不小的威胁。在这种情况下,网络流量监测技术成为了一种必不可少的手段,可以快速识别网络攻击并采取措施。本文将深入探讨网络流量监测技术的应用和实现原理。 一、什么是网络流量监测技术? 网络流量监测技术是一种网络安全技术,可以实时监测网络上的流量情况,并分析它们的特征,从而识别出网络攻击。网络流量是指在网络中传输的数据包,可以是用户请求、网站响应、电子邮件等。网络流量监测技术可以对这些数据包进行完整性检查、筛选、过滤和分析,并提供实时的告警和报告。 二、网络流量监测技术的实现原理 网络流量监测技术的实现原理主要有两种:一种是基于网络流量指纹库的技术,另一种是基于机器学习的技术。 1. 基于网络流量指纹库的技术 网络流量指纹是一种网络数据包的特征,可以用来识别网络攻击。网络流量指纹库是一组预定义的网络流量指纹,可以用来比对网络流量中是否存在已知的攻击特征。基于网络流量指纹库的技术主要有以下步骤: (1)收集网络流量数据包 (2)提取网络流量指纹 (3)比对网络流量指纹库 (4)识别是否存在攻击特征 (5)进行告警和处理 2. 基于机器学习的技术 机器学习是一种人工智能的应用领域,可以让计算机自主学习和优化算法。基于机器学习的网络流量监测技术主要有以下步骤: (1)收集网络流量数据包 (2)提取网络流量特征 (3)训练机器学习模型 (4)使用机器学习模型分析网络流量数据包 (5)识别是否存在攻击特征 (6)进行告警和处理 三、网络流量监测技术的应用 网络流量监测技术在网络安全中有着广泛的应用。 1. 快速发现网络攻击 网络流量监测技术可以实时监测网络流量数据包,快速发现网络攻击,并进行告警和处理。 2. 提高网络安全性 网络流量监测技术可以对网络流量进行深度检测,提高网络安全性,避免网络攻击造成的损失。 3. 优化网络运维 网络流量监测技术可以收集和分析网络流量数据包,为网络运维提供数据支持,帮助优化网络性能和安全性。 四、总结 网络流量监测技术是一种重要的网络安全技术,可以实时监测网络流量数据包,判断是否存在网络攻击,并进行告警和处理。本文介绍了网络流量监测技术的应用和实现原理,可以为网络安全工作者提供一些帮助。同时,要注意网络流量监测技术的局限性,不能完全替代其他网络安全技术。